The Contemporary Urban Centre is a dynamic and versatile Grade II converted warehouse in the heart of Liverpool’s Independent Arts Quarter, it is an arts, cultural and social enterprise hub focusing on the diverse needs of Black and Minority Ethnic groups and other excluded communities. Extremely close to the main docks and Echo Arena and recently shortlisted for the main aftershow party of the MTV awards (site visit completed by Steve Smith from Ear to the Ground), we have some really exciting high speciafication performance and bar areas which can interlink to a capacity of 1500. Each room is highly individual designed and provide a real talking point for events. The building features: · Live music and performance venues, studio & main theatre (capacity 750 standing) & cinema · Art galleries · Offices and creative studios · Conference & function rooms · Bars, restaurants & lounges · Retail & social enterprise stalls Owned by the award winning charity Novas Scarman Group, the CUC is an ethical, inclusive and stylish venue with a strong community support ethos. The venue is a major regeneration catalyst of the waterfront area of Liverpool, shortlisted for many Renewal and Regeneration Awards and advocated by development agencies and the government as an outstanding success of European Capital of Culture 2008.
